Definitions:

Activity-Based Costing

A costing method that assigns overhead and indirect costs to specific activities related to the production of goods or services.

Materials Handling

Activities involved in moving, storing, controlling, and protecting materials and products throughout the manufacturing, warehousing, distribution, consumption, and disposal processes.

Allocation Rate

A financial metric used to assign indirect costs to different projects or departments within an organization.

Total Overhead

The total of all indirect costs associated with the manufacturing process, including indirect labor, materials, and other expenses necessary for production.
